CVE-2024-3097
The NextGEN Gallery plugin for WordPress contained a broken access control flaw that allowed unauthenticated or low-privileged users to perform actions requiring higher privileges due to missing authorization checks and nonce validation. This vulnerability was discovered by Peng Zhou and affected all versions before 3.59.1, where the issue was remedied.
